What is the repossession order?

A repossession order is a legal document that allows a lender or creditor to reclaim property from a borrower who has defaulted on their loan or lease agreement. This process typically occurs when the borrower fails to make payments as agreed. The repossession order serves as a formal notice that the lender has the right to take back the property, which may include vehicles, equipment, or other financed items. Understanding this order is crucial for borrowers, as it outlines their rights and responsibilities during the repossession process.

Legal use of the repossession order

The legal use of a repossession order is governed by state laws and regulations, which can vary significantly across the United States. It is essential for lenders to understand these laws to ensure that their repossession actions are lawful. This includes adhering to notification requirements, allowing the borrower a chance to rectify the default, and following proper procedures during the repossession. Failure to comply with these legal standards can result in penalties, including lawsuits or damages awarded to the borrower.

Key elements of the repossession order

Several key elements must be included in a repossession order for it to be considered valid. These elements typically include:

  • The name and contact information of the lender and borrower
  • A detailed description of the property being repossessed
  • The specific terms of the loan or lease agreement
  • The reason for the repossession, such as missed payments
  • The date the order was issued

Inclusion of these elements helps ensure clarity and legality, protecting both the lender's rights and the borrower's interests.

State-specific rules for the repossession order

Each state has its own rules and regulations governing repossession orders, which can affect how the process is conducted. For example, some states require lenders to provide a notice of default before initiating repossession, while others may have specific timelines for how quickly a repossession must occur after default. It is important for both lenders and borrowers to familiarize themselves with their state's laws to avoid potential legal issues. Consulting with a legal expert can provide guidance tailored to specific situations.

Required documents for repossession

To initiate a repossession order, certain documents are typically required. These may include:

  • The original loan or lease agreement
  • Proof of default, such as payment records
  • The completed repossession order form
  • Any relevant correspondence with the borrower regarding the default

Having these documents prepared and organized can streamline the repossession process and help ensure compliance with legal requirements.

Penalties for non-compliance with repossession laws

Failure to adhere to repossession laws can result in significant penalties for lenders. These penalties may include financial damages awarded to the borrower, loss of the right to repossess the property, and potential legal action against the lender. Additionally, non-compliance can damage a lender's reputation and lead to regulatory scrutiny. It is crucial for lenders to follow all legal protocols to avoid these consequences and ensure a fair process for all parties involved.
